Kenya to Update Certificate of Origin Requirements

21 Jul 2025 | Alex Sonifrank

The American World Trade Chamber of Commerce (AWTCC) has gotten multiple reports from exporters seeking to do business in Kenya that they are facing new requirements. The Kenya Revenue Authority issued new regulation which impacts current US shipments destined for Kenya. The notice outlines a short grace period, suggesting US exporters shipping to Kenya need to quickly ensure their process is aligned with the new rules. The notice outlines clearly the amendment regarding the certificate of origin, stating: “mandatory for all consignments imported into Kenya to be accompanied by a Certificate of Origin (COO) issued by a competent authority from the country of export.” The full text of the notice is available below.

The Specifics

The notice details information required for the certificate of origin. This information is aligned with the International Chamber of Commerce guidelines and aligned with the requirements set by AWTCC. Chamber stamps on certificates of origin are available to companies registering with AWTCC which would ensure compliance with the new requirement.

Further, exporters have reported receiving samples of certificates of origin that qualify under the ICC CO accreditation chain. AWTCC meets this standard and as such certificates of origin issued by AWTCC will be in line with expectations of customs in Kenya.

The notice also details that penalties will be issued for failure to comply, which can include fines and seizure of goods.

Letter of Credit Training for Exporters

The American World Trade Chamber of Commerce (AWTCC) in effort to expand opportunities for education has partnered with Trade Technologies around their upcoming letter of credit training. AWTCC has established a discount for members which will discount the training course to $65. The event will be Wednesday, August 20th at 01:00pm EDT and will focus on documentation in the letter of credit process. Letters of credit are likely to get more common in the near future as exporters are looking to new destinations and new opportunities. In these situations, letters of credit can offer more safety for the buyer and seller both but also come with more work. Trade Technologies has focused on navigating this process and the training course provided will help US exporters learn how best to navigate and handle letter of credit requirements.

Announcing Alliance with the US – India Importer’s Council

The American World Trade Chamber of Commerce (AWTCC) and the US – India Importer's Council (USIIC) entered into a cooperative arrangement on June 6th, 2025. This arrangement was made official in the joint signing of a memorandum of understanding (MOU) between the two parties. Each of the signing parties have unique interest in facilitating and advancing trade between the United States and India. The USIIC operates 10 branches across India and represents members across the country. The alliance here will allow members of both AWTCC and USIIC to benefit from new connections. India represents unique value to AWTCC as it is the top export destination for companies participating in their documentation platform.

Mexican Customs Begins Crackdown on USMCA Qualification Claims

For some time, US businesses have been able to export to Mexico with very little oversight. While the risk of audits has always been there, the likelihood has been historically low. Today though, US companies are more and more often needing to demonstrate how they qualify for USMCA. Companies are being often caught by surprise, needing to demonstrate how their product qualifies as US origin under the terms of the USMCA agreement.
